Common Issues with Patio Doors
Regardless of their sturdiness, patio doors can face different concerns that require attention. Here are some of the most common problems:
-
Leaking or Drafting
- Cause: Gaps in the door frame, worn weatherstripping, or a misaligned door.
- Option: Replace weatherstripping, adjust the door positioning, or seal gaps with caulk.
-
Problem in Opening or Closing
- Trigger: Misaligned tracks, particles in the tracks, or worn rollers.
- Option: Clean the tracks, realign the door, or replace the rollers.
-
Misting or Condensation Between Glass Panes
- Trigger: Broken seal on the insulated glass unit.
- Option: Replace the glass unit.
-
Broken or Broken Glass
- Trigger: Impact from external objects or age-related wear.
- Service: Replace the glass panel.
-
Faulty Locking Mechanisms
- Trigger: Wear and tear, rust, or damage.
- Solution: Lubricate the lock, replace used parts, or install a new lock.
-
Warped or Damaged Frame
- Cause: Exposure to wetness, temperature level changes, or physical damage.
- Option: Repair or replace the broken sections of the frame.

FAQs About Local Patio Door Repairs
Q: How often should I have my patio door examined for prospective problems?
- A: It is suggested to examine your patio door a minimum of when a year. Patio Door Company can help recognize and attend to small concerns before they end up being significant issues.
Q: Can I repair a patio door myself, or should I work with an expert?
- A: While some minor concerns can be resolved with DIY options, more complex problems must be managed by an expert. Incorrect repairs can cause further damage and security threats.
Q: What should I do if my patio door is dripping?
- A: First, check for spaces in the door frame and replace any worn weatherstripping. If the problem continues, it may be an indication of a more serious issue, such as a misaligned door or a harmed frame, which should be dealt with by a professional.
Q: How can I avoid fogging in between the glass panes of my patio door?
- A: Fogging is frequently a sign of a damaged seal on the insulated glass unit. To prevent this, make sure the door is properly sealed and keep a consistent indoor temperature. If fogging happens, the glass unit will require to be replaced.
Q: What are the signs that my patio door needs to be replaced instead of repaired?
- A: If the door is substantially distorted, the frame is badly harmed, or the door no longer offers adequate insulation or security, it may be time to consider a replacement. A specialist can examine the condition of your door and offer recommendations.
